Heheh just when I thought No 7's Intelligent Balance was as good as it got for foundation...I think I've found my HG!

Saw Max Factor's 'Second Skin' advertised and that you could get a free sample by registering on their website so I did that, got the sample....and it's soooooooooo good! It does exactly what a good foundation should - just evens out your skintone rather than masking it completely - my skin looks even but not obviously like I've got foundation on. Looked in a mirror tonight when I'd my foundation on for 10 hours - and my skin still looked smooth and even, it hadn't 'disappeared' like other foundation normally does after that long - even after a full day at work in a very warm office!

Very, very pleased with it - so I popped into Superdrug and bought a full size bottle! Can't recommend it highly enough [http://community.handbag.com/ver1.0/content/scripts/tinymce/plugins/emotions/images/talk016.gif]
